Richard Frederick POWELL, III, Petitioner, v. The EIGHTH JUDICIAL DISTRICT COURT of the State of Nevada, IN AND FOR the COUNTY OF CLARK; and the Honorable Eric Johnson, District Judge, Respondents, Renee Baker, Warden; and the State of Nevada, Real Parties in Interest.
ORDER GRANTING PETITION FOR REHEARING AND VACATING ORDER DENYING PETITION
Having considered the petition for rehearing, we have determined that rehearing of the matter is warranted. Accordingly, we vacate the Order Denying Petition, entered on August 8, 2019, and we grant the petition for rehearing and submit this matter for decision on rehearing without further briefing or oral argument. See NRAP 40(e).
We further direct the clerk of this court to administratively close Docket No. 79458, which was filed as a new petition for a writ of mandamus or prohibition, and file petitioner's second supplemental petition for a writ of mandamus or writ of prohibition, and motion to strike, in this docket. We further direct the clerk of this court to file this order in Docket No. 79458.
It is so ordered.
